New evidence of plagiarism in FG TD Flanagan's speeches
Fine Gael's Terrance Flanagan has been caught copying his Dáil colleagues work again.
It has emerged that the Dublin North East TD has used excerpts from other people's speeches at least six times.
The Sunday Times examined the Dáil record and found that Deputy Flanagan had borrowed work from Labour's Joanna Tuffy, Sinn Féin's Caoimhghin Ó Caoláin and Fine Gael's Brian Hayes.
The plagiarism first came to light after he admitted copying a speech originally made by Labour's Joan Burton last month.
However, Mr Flanagan disputes these new cases, saying the repetition came about because he was using research material provided by Fine Gael.
